Assesment of genetic parameters for yield and it’s components in blackgram (Vigna mungo (L.) Hepper)

Author(s):
E Rambabu, CH Anuradha, Abdus Subhan Salman Mohd, V Sridhar, S Vanisri and Bharati N Bhat
Abstract:
Estimation of genetic parameters like Mean, Range, Variance, Genotypic coefficient of variation, Phenotypic coefficient of variation, Heritability, Genetic advance and Genetic advance as per cent of mean for ten yield and its related traits like height of the plant, number of branches, number of clusters, number of pods per plant, length of the pod, number of seeds per pod, days to 50 per cent flowering, days to maturity, single plant yield and 100 seed weight in two replications were performed in 177 plants of F2:3 population of blackgram derived from cross MBG-207 × PU-31 during summer season 2018-19 at ARS, Madhira, Khammam. Random block design (RBD) analysis was carried out and observations from ANOVA table were considered to know the variations as high and low values in different traits that will contribute to yield in blackgram crop.
